Margaret Thatcher, pictured with her husband Denis, leaving for first day in House of Lords. 30th June 1992

EDITORS COMMENTS
In this print from Memory Lane Prints, we are transported back to the historic moment when Margaret Thatcher, the iconic Iron Lady of British politics, embarked on her first day in the House of Lords. The year was 1992, and as she stood alongside her devoted husband Denis Thatcher, their determination and unwavering commitment to public service radiated from their expressions. Margaret Thatcher's political journey had been nothing short of extraordinary. As a Conservative politician who rose through the ranks with sheer tenacity and intellect, she shattered glass ceilings along the way. This image captures a pivotal chapter in her remarkable career as she took on yet another challenge – becoming Baroness Thatcher of Kesteven. The couple stands outside their cherished residence in Chester Square before departing for this momentous occasion. Their home served not only as a place of solace but also witnessed countless discussions about policy decisions that would shape an era. It symbolizes both personal triumphs and sacrifices made for public duty.
